How much do event design j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 12, 2026, the average hourly pay for event design in Atlanta, GA is $16.57,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.85 and $18.51 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Event Design vs Event Planning?

AspectEvent DesignEvent Planning
Primary FocusCreating the visual and thematic concept of an eventOrganizing logistics, timelines, and vendor coordination
Skills NeededCreativity, design, aestheticsOrganization, communication, project management
Work EnvironmentDesign studios, client meetings, on-site setupVendor meetings, on-site coordination, timeline management
Common UsageIn event conceptualization and decorIn overall event execution and logistics

Event Design focuses on the visual and thematic aspects of an event, creating the overall look and feel. Event Planning involves managing the logistics, vendors, and timelines to ensure the event runs smoothly. Both roles often collaborate but serve different core functions in the event industry.

What are some common challenges faced by professionals in event design and how can they be addressed?

Event Design professionals often encounter challenges such as managing tight deadlines, balancing creative concepts with client budgets, and coordinating with multiple vendors and stakeholders. To address these challenges, it is important to maintain clear communication, develop detailed timelines, and stay flexible to adapt to last-minute changes. Building strong relationships with trusted suppliers and using project management tools can also help streamline the process and ensure a successful event execution.

What is event design?

Event design is the process of creating the overall look, feel, and atmosphere of an event. It involves developing a cohesive concept that includes elements like theme, color scheme, decor, lighting, and layout to enhance the attendee experience. Event designers work closely with clients to understand their vision and transform it into a memorable and visually appealing event. Their work can range from weddings and corporate gatherings to large-scale festivals and conferences.
